Rozen sometimes drags boring fights out of certain guys in defeat. Blaydes, Gane and now Sergei all had duds against him despite being ahead the entire time. Can't forget that Jair has like 89 KB fights and an 87% KO rate in MMA.

he had to, and you could see it coming. two losses in a row, fighting an extremely dangerous striker - it was a put-the-wheels-back-on kind of fight, get the win any way you can. he fought a very smart fight, outduel him on the feet for half a round and then coast on the TD for the second half. personally i was just relieved he didn't look completely gunshy, that was the other distinct possibility.
